WebCommemorative Issues. $1 Western Cattle in Storm single. Unlike definitives, commemorative stamps are printed in limited numbers to honor an event, person, or specific theme. Postmaster General John Wanamaker issued the nation's first commemorative stamps in 1893. Web29 sep. 2024 · The U.S. Postal Service in Maryland, which has seen some of the worst postal delays in the country, is getting new leadership. Lora McLucas will become the new USPS district manager for Maryland, and Eric Gilbert will be the new Baltimore postmaster, Rep. C.A. Dutch Ruppersberger (D-Md.) announced. Web31 mrt. 2024 · 11-9131 Postmasters and Mail Superintendents Plan, direct, or coordinate operational, administrative, management, and support services of a U.S. post office; or coordinate activities of workers engaged in postal and related work in assigned post office. History; List of postmasters general; Under the Continental Congress; U.S. Post Office Department, 1789–1971 gage watchesWebMary Katherine Goddard, only known woman Postmaster when Benjamin Franklin was named the first American Postmaster General Abraham Lincoln, US president that abolished slavery Monroe Morton, African American Postmaster of Georgia Isaac Nichols, first postmaster of Australia's post Tammy Flores Garman Schoenen, first female … gage waterproof backpackWeb23 aug. 2024 · Every post office has a postmaster who is the manager of that branch, overseeing operations and employees. The median annual salary for postmasters was $71,670 in May 2016. A median salary is the midpoint in a list of salaries, with half earning more and half earning less.
